Tactical suspenders: a trip to the past

The first mentions of suspenders for trousers date back to the 17th century. They appeared in France. The idea of their creation comes from a sword belt. Gradually, this idea was improved and an accessory similar to a modern one was obtained. Subsequently, the Germans, in particular the Bavarians and Tyroleans, used suspenders as a mandatory element of traditional clothing.

The Englishman Albert Thorston is considered the inventor of men's braces in their modern form. He began selling them in his shop in 1820. A feature of the design was fastening with loops for buttons, which were sewn from the inner or outer waist part of the pants, and a more universal fastening appeared later.

Mark Twain contributed to the improvement of suspenders by patenting in 1871 a clip for adjusting their length according to the figure. The clip-clamp, which allows you to quickly transfer suspenders from one trousers to another, was patented in the USA in 1894.

Suspenders were also a comfortable accessory for the working class, especially in the United States, where they became very popular. Aristocrats of Europe also showed interest in this accessory. Today, suspenders for pants are in demand among both men and women. They have become not only a functional wardrobe item, but also a stylish accessory that matches different looks and allows you to add diversity to them.

Suspenders for trousers: varieties and their features

Looking at the range of braces in stores, one is struck by their diversity. They differ in sizes, colors, materials, styles, design features, etc. Today we will talk exclusively about tactical braces. They are suitable for military personnel and lovers of active recreation. In general, there are three types of fasteners:

  • on the buttons under the loops on the trousers;
  • on universal clips;
  • on carabiners for waist belt.

Most modern models of army braces are produced on universal clips — "on crocodiles". This fixation is considered the most reliable. In addition, it allows you to easily put them on and take them off if necessary.

The size of braces depends on the person's height. The most popular sizes are 90, 100 and 110. Most models are universal, as the straps are equipped with adjustable fasteners.

As a rule, polyester is used as the main material for the manufacture of belts. Rubber and leather military suspenders are less common. Accessories are made of plastic and metals. Suspenders are an all-season accessory, so wearing them does not depend on the season.

When choosing tactical suspenders, you should take into account their strength, elasticity, length adjustment and type of fixation. Correctly selected suspenders will serve you for years.
